Atmel offers microcontrollers and microprocessors based on its proprietary 8- and 32-bit AVR, and ARM's Cortex-M3, ARM7, and ARM9. Over the previous year, the company introduced the ATtiny4/5/9/10 offered in a Flash microcontroller package measuring 2x2 mm. The picoPower 32-bit AVR UC3L lowers power consumption by up to 90 percent. This device runs on 165 µA/MHz in active mode, 600 nA with RTC running, and down to 9 nA with all clocks stopped.

Atmel QTouch Library and Atmel QTouch Studio expanded this year and now support all AVR microcontrollers. The company announced FPU (Floating point unit) technology that will be designed into selected AVR UC3 microcontrollers targeting applications in the automotive and industrial control markets.

The ATmega128RFA1, Atmel's first IEEE 802.15.4 compliant single-chip solution, combines an AVR microcontroller with a 2.4GHz RF transceiver. Atmel's BitCloud Profile Suite is a ready-to-use framework for rapid development of ZigBee-certified applications. The suite includes a complete set of fully functional reference implementations of the ZigBee Application Profiles for ZSE (ZigBee Smart Energy), ZBA (ZigBee Building Automation), and ZHA (ZigBee Home Automation).

The company's new SAM3S series of Cortex-M3 based Flash microcontrollers feature ODT (On-Die Termination), USB Device, SDIO, Parallel PIO signal capture, 12-bit ADC and DAC, 4 UARTs, dual I²C, I²S, timers, unique chip ID, and power and reset management.

Atmel introduced three new members to its SAM9 family of ARM926EJ-based embedded microprocessors. The SAM9M10 and SAM9M11 are multimedia enabled embedded microprocessors with integrated video decoder and 2D accelerator, offering DDR2, SDRAM, NOR Flash, and NAND Flash support. The SAM9M11 adds on-chip hardware accelerators with DMA support to enable high-speed data encryption and authentication of the transferred data or application via AES, TDES, SHA1, SHA256 and True Random Number Generator. The SAM9G46 includes the same security peripherals as the SAM9M11 and targets high performance and high-speed serial communication applications with a peripheral set including 10/100 Ethernet, HS SDIO/SD/MMC and HS USB 2.0 Host and Device.
